Society doesn't like to punch down but loves punching up.

Love on the Spectrum is portrayed positively because no one feels threatened by autistic people (well, individual interactions are a different topic). Therefore, making a spectacle of it would be punching down, showing that people who already are disadvantaged in life can have more challenges beyond the inherent ones.

People don't like confronting their insecurities or jealousy, so people who have those sorted and are at peace with them feel threatening because it reminds them of their lack of peace. Poly also represents working through those, and realizing the taboo desires of non monogamy. There's a lot of projection and people feel inferior, so portraying these relationships negatively feels like punching up to them. Its fair game to tear it to pieces, and it feels really good because it validates them for adhering to boundaries they didn't necessarily choose for themselves.

What are the current trends in music? by CuriousTriceratop in Music

[–]KitsBeach 11 points12 points  (0 children)

I feel like when you're in the middle of the trend its harder to spot, although I definitely remember mid dubstep craze thinking "this has to be a trend", especially once Britney Spears put out a song with a dubstep drop lol. 

Stutter was a trend in EDM 2 (3?) years ago. I'm hoping that using samples of long spoken pieces with no melody over an instrumental is a phase because I don't like lots of that in a playlist, maybe one song max. In pop we are definitely saturated by the ballad girlies. Another trend is when one tiny piece of the song is an earworm to be used in shorts/reels/tiktoks but for some reason none of the rest of the song matches that energy. Phonk was popular 1-2 years ago.
